How many AMS controllers are installed?
One controller with two channels which control the respective on side system
What does the Air management system (AMS) use bleed air for?
ECS (heating and cooling) Engine start Pressurization Engine and wing anti-ice Water pressure Hot air leak detection
What happens if the channel fails?
The remaining channel is able to control the entire AMS
What provides air for the AMS?
Engine bleeds
APU bleed
External Pneumatic Source
What is bleed air used for?
ECS (heating and cooling)
Engine start
Engine and wing anti-ice
Water pressure
What is external pneumatic air used for?
ECS on the ground
Engine start on the ground
Where is the external ground source panel located?
Lower faring between the wings
What is the primary use for APU bleed air?
ECS on the ground
Engine starting on the ground
Electrical source (<15,000 ft MSL)
Can engine bleed air flow back to the APU?
No. A check valve prevents flow back
Where is bleed air tapped from the engines?
6th and 10th stage compressors (EBV and HSV respectively)
System alternates between valves to regulate an adequate and safe pressure
What is normal pressure for any engine operation?
45 psi
What is the purpose of the pre-cooler?
Cools the bleed air coming from the engine to the AMS
What cools the pre-cooler?
Ground N1 fan
Flight N1 fan or ram air
What does the Overheat Detection System (ODS) Observe?
Engine bleeds and packs
APU bleed
Plumbing for the wing and engine anti-ice system
To both loops have to function in order to detect and overheat condition?
Yes, but if one fails the other will work alone to detect the overheat
How many ECS packs are on the airplane? What provides air for the packs?
Two independent packs (left and right)
Each engine provides bleed air to its respective pack
Can a single pack provide adequate temperature control and pressurization?
Yes, up to FL310
Can a single bleed source power both packs?
Yes, through the cross bleed valve
What is the ratio of fresh air to recirculated air?
52% fresh air to 48% recycled air
When are the recirculation fans commanded off?
Cockpit switch
Smoke detected in the recirculated bay
DUMP button is pressed
Respective pack is commanded off
What keeps the three avionic E-BAYs cool?
- FWD & CRT E-BAY Three fans pull air from cabin to bay
* AFT E-BAY Natural air-flow from cabin to bay
When is the Emergency Ram Air Ventilation Activated?
Both packs commanded or failed OFF below 25,000 feet (via left side with electronic control)
Ram air pressure greater than cabin pressure (via right side)
How many channels on the Cabin Pressure Control (CPC)?
2 channels, 1 active and 1 in standby mode
Where does the CPC get Landing Field Elevation (LFE)?
FMS or can be manually selected
